Four Civilians Injured in Indian Firing at LoC

Azad Kashmir (July 17, 2017): Four people including a woman were injured when Indian forces yet again resorted to unprovoked firing and shelling in various areas of Nakyal Sector along the Line of Control from across the border.

According to sources the unprovoked firing and shelling by Indian forces in in Tarkandi area of Nakyal Sector also completely destroyed three houses.

The Pak Army gave a speedy and befitting reply to the Indian aggression.

It may be mentioned here that yesterday Indian troops targeted an Army vehicle moving along Neelum River on Line of Control at Athmuqam in Azad Kashmir.According to ISPR, the vehicle fell into the River and four soldiers drowned. Body of one martyr was been recovered and search for remaining three is in progress.

The vehicle plunged into Neelum River. Body of one martyred soldier has been recovered, while search is on for the remaining three, the statement read.

On July 10, five Pakistani civilians, including four women, were martyred after Indian troops resorted to unprovoked firing Rawalakot sector, Satwal, Manwal, Tatrinote areas. The incident also left four others, including three girls, injured.

In response, Pakistan Army destroyed two Indian checkposts leaving four enemy troops dead.
